Can I retake the JLPT if I do not pass?
Yes, you can retake the JLPT in subsequent administrations. There is no limit to the number of times you can attempt the test.
2. How frequently is the JLPT held?
The JLPT is held twice a year, usually in July and December. However, the specific schedule might differ by region.
